GREETINGS, TF2 COMMUNITY.
skill always beats luck. Be real, be good players.






some alerts that can tell us if a player is a Bot:
•There are two or more players with the same username in the game.
•They usually use Sniper and are aiming up or spinning.
•Check their game statistics, they are usually at the top of the player rankings.
•Other players who usually have Sniper on are not attacked by this bot.
•They have users like "omegatronic", "hexatronic", "sydney", "Electric gem", "Lila rain", etc, etc.
Together we can stop the threat, and make TF2 a better place for everyone. Every time I go there makes a bot, remember to take a photo of their username, start a votekick, and be on the lookout to eliminate any suspicious players

Are you looking for tips to detect and avoid scams in the Steam TF2 Community Market? I've got you covered!
First, be sure to verify that the person you are doing business with is a legitimate user. You can do this by checking your trading history and account level. If the account looks suspiciously new or has a low reputation level, it may be a scam, too. Check that the user you are dealing with is truly the owner of the item you want to purchase. If they have a private profile or they simply send you a link to the other user's post, then you are probably being scammed.
Second, consider using a trusted intermediary to help facilitate the exchange. This helps avoid any problems of misunderstandings or errors in exchanges.
Also, Keep your eyes peeled for all sales posts. If something is priced too good to be true, then it's probably a scam.
To add, if you know that the item you want to buy is of high value, ask other experienced players if the price is fair. If they are not sure, then be very careful.

Greetings, TF2 community!
Have you played against TF2 bots lately? You may have seen bot names like “Omegaapocalipsys,” “Sidney,” or “I WILL BE BACK SOON.” These bots are a pest in the game, but don't worry, here are some things you can do to help eradicate them.
•First of all, remember that bots are not invincible. Although they can kill in the game, they do not have the same ability to work as a team or devise strategy as human players. Therefore, if you work as a team with other players, you can probably beat the bots.
•Second, consider joining a community that is active in fighting bots. There are many communities of TF2 players that are dedicated to eradicating bots, and working together as a community is the most effective way to combat these problems.
•Third, you can vote to ban the bot. If players report a bot, a vote can be started to ban the bot. You can press the "Esc" key to open the pause menu and select the option to vote in the bot. If the majority of players vote to ban the bot, it will be banned from the server.
•As a last piece of advice, we recommend muting the bots, since they often play music at very high volume or sounds that can be annoying for some people.
Remember that bots are not humans, and do not deserve to be treated as such. We must be strong and not give in to this threat.

Hello TF2 community!
Have you played the Team Fortress 2 video game recently? If you are still playing, you may have noticed a plague of computer programs (bots) that have been specifically designed to ruin your matches and make the game almost unplayable. These bots are known as "omegatronic" and are a big problem in the TF2 community.
"Omegatronic bots" are bots that have been created by malicious programmers specifically to annoy human players and make the game very difficult to ENJOY. These bots are organized into "hordes" and connect to group games, meaning that a horde of bots can ruin the game for many players at the same time. Additionally, the bots are programmed to move and shoot very effectively, making them difficult to defeat in a real match. The TF2 community has been fighting against these bots for some time, and they are putting pressure on Valve to fix the problem.
However, "omegatronics" are still a big problem for the game, and many players are choosing to stop playing until Valve finds an effective solution. If you are a TF2 player and are concerned about "omegatronics", there are a few things you can do to help combat the problem:
• Report any bots you see and ask other players to do the same.
•If you are in a game with a bot, try to convince the other players to vote to remove them from the game.
• If you are playing with friends, try to have everyone play on a private server together to avoid bots.
As members of the TF2 community, it is important that we work together to combat this issue and keep the game alive and enjoyable for everyone.
